GEORGIA A. CROWTHER

PLATTEVILLE, Wis. - Georgia A. Crowther, 89, of Platteville, died Friday, May 30, 1997, at Orchard Manor Nursing Home, rural Lancaster.

Services will be at 11 a.m. Monday at Bendorf Funeral Home, Platteville, with the Rev. Thomas M. Miller officiating. Burial will be in Greenwood Cemetery, Platteville. Friends may call from 4 to 8 p.m. today at the funeral home.

Mrs. Crowther was born on July 4, 1907, near Ellenboro, daughter of John Henry and Ada (Baker) Brogley. She married Joseph Allen "Cookie" Crowther on Oct. 19, 1940, in Dubuque; he died on Sept. 21, 1980.

Georgia enjoyed visiting local nursing homes to visit with the residents.

Surviving are a sister, Ruth Cordes, of Davison, Mich.; a sister-in-law, Doris Brogley, of Moline, Ill.; nine nieces and nephews, Jack Brogley and Beverly Klonglond, both of Madison, Annabelle Brunton, of Platteville, Madge Noyes, of Jackson, Miss., Fay Ohlert, of Maquoketa, Iowa, Josephine Flesch, of Evansville, Judy Brumbaugh and Carol Peterson, both of Moline, and Jon Cordes, of Seal Beach, Calif.; many great-nieces and nephews; and other relatives and friends.

She also was preceded in death by a son, Lyle James Mann, from her first marriage; her parents; two sisters, Marie Carolyn Brogley, in infancy, and Ada Odessa Ohlert; and two brothers, Maynard and Lyle Brogley.
